SpaceFM Commended

The Management and Staff of a Sunyani-based Private Radio Station, Space 87.7 Fm were on Friday given tons of commendation by the people of Brong Ahafo Region for opening a new chapter in broadcasting standards in the Region.

But for the timely intervention of Mr. Ransford Antwi (pictured) a Director and General Manager of the station, the on-going registration exercise (taking of pictures) in the Brong Ahafo Region would have been dealt a big blow, after cameramen had embarked on a sit-down strike to compel the Electoral Commission to come out how much the latter was going to give them (the Cameramen) after the exercise.

The Director, whose Station (Space FM) was then doing a LIVE coverage of the exercise had gone to the District Electoral office to see how best the issue could be resolved. After the issue had been partially resolved, the issue that once again threatened the exercise was how to transport the cameramen back to their various centres. And with the leadership of the EC not present at the time, Mr. Antwi volunteered to pay the transportation of most of the Cameramen and again used his Car to transport the rest, a gesture many think is highly patriotic and exemplary and therefore, needs commendation.

Space Fm was highly commended for their extensive coverage during the first phase of the Registration exercise, when the came out with super jingle in all dialects, calling on the people of the Brong Ahafo Region to register, in the interest of mother Ghana. It was this same station that caused a stir nation-wide, by exposing the EC for using expired indelible in the National Registration exercise.

In an interview, Mr. Ransford Antwi stated that he only one of the many things the station was set up to accomplish (commitment to national cause), and therefore believes ?it?s no big deal?
